About the role:

This role will be working on the IP West of England Area Programme and covers a wide range of multidisciplinary projects including junction remodelling, re-signalling and introduction of new trains.

Civil Engineering input will be required for these projects.

What you will do:

Implement Rail systems and procedures to maintain a cost effective, high quality, safe and environmentally responsible approach to design, construction, commissioning and other technical activities on relevant projects, compliant with all relevant legislation.

Monitor specific projects managed by Infrastructure Investment so that they are engineered to the standards and specification.

Manage all engineering activities so that they result in schemes that are affordable and meet programme requirements.

Maintain the use of relevant techniques and procedures of quantified and qualitative risk assessment and HAZOP analysis to allocated projects and manage the environmental aspects of allocated projects.

Provide project management advice in respect of all construction activities, including testing and commissioning and site supervision.

Manage so that the design/construction elements of relevant projects meet the requirements of current legislation, including construction design management (CDM) regulations.

Undertake reviews of design/construction activities.

Your experience will include: Ideally you will hold Network Rail experience and experience of assuring designers and contractors from GRIP 3 - 7.

Previous experience in civil engineering in a rail environment Chartered Engineer is desirable

Experience with stations, buildings and platforms coupled with knowledge of gauging

Experience in multidiscipline project environment including civils renewals Managing stakeholders including sponsors, asset managers, train operators, and any other stakeholders

About our client

Our client is the largest rail infrastructure business in the country and is at the operational centre of the railway and playing a key role in a rapidly evolving industry.

They are responsible for rebuilding Britain's railway infrastructure and are managing some of the biggest and most complex engineering programmes in Europe.

Over the next five years they will be spending around GBP23 billion to maintain and upgrade every aspect of an infrastructure that comprises 21,000 miles of track, 2,500 stations, 9,000 level crossings, 40,000 bridges and tunnels, and signalling and power for the movement of 25,000 trains every day.
